Acer Nitro 5: Budget-Friendly Gaming with a Few Compromises

The Acer Nitro 5 is a popular choice for budget-minded gamers. It offers a good balance of performance and affordability, but there are a few trade-offs to consider. Here's a look at the pros and cons to help you decide if the Acer Nitro 5 is the right gaming laptop for you.

Pros:

  • Excellent Value: The Nitro 5 consistently ranks among the most affordable laptops with the hardware to run modern games at decent settings.
  • Strong Performance: With a variety of configurations featuring AMD Ryzen/Intel processors and Nvidia GeForce RTX graphics cards, you can choose a Nitro 5 that meets your gaming needs without breaking the bank.
  • 144Hz Refresh Rate Display: Many configurations offer a 1080p display with a 144Hz refresh rate, providing smooth visuals for fast-paced gameplay.

  • Upgradable RAM and Storage: Unlike some thin and light gaming laptops, the Nitro 5 allows you to upgrade the RAM and storage yourself, giving you more control over performance and capacity.
  • Keyboard Backlighting: The backlit keyboard with customizable RGB lighting adds a touch of flair and makes it easier to see the keys in low-light environments.

Cons:

  • Dim Display: While the refresh rate is great, some reviewers find the display to be on the dimmer side, especially compared to higher-end gaming laptops.
  • Plastic Build Quality: The chassis is primarily constructed of plastic, which can feel less premium compared to laptops with aluminum construction.
  • Average Battery Life: Don't expect to game for hours on end unplugged. The battery life is sufficient for light tasks but will need to be plugged in for extended gaming sessions.
  • Loud Fans: Under heavy load, the cooling fans can get quite loud, which might be bothersome for some users.
